WELCOME TO KOSTO

Plan your visit

Drop by for a coffee, a bite, or just the vibe. We’re open every day, no booking needed.

Opening hours

Monday to Friday: 8am–10pm
Saturday & Sunday: 10am–6pm

Address

35 Quai des Péniches – Brussels
Along the canal, near Tour & Taxis
